Hi All,

Wanted to add to the existing information for those concerned with sludge in their engines. The front valve cover gasket was leaking more and more so I decided to do something about it. I purchased the car 2 years ago with 62k miles on it. Today it has 83k miles. It has always had regular oil changes at the toyota dealer. Once I got it I switched to Mobil 1 5w-30 and Pure One filter with 5k intervals with mixed city/hwy driving.

The leak wasn't really a huge deal at all. It was just creating some oil residue around the valve cover and especially on the side where the seal has to go over the cam. It has just gotten progressively worse over time. There wasn't any oil running down the engine or anything like that. Just something I wanted to address now. It was there before I switched to mobil 1 I don't think the oil had any negative effect on it.
